Gross monthly incomeis set at 165 …Gross monthly income (130 percent of poverty) Net monthly income (100 percent of poverty) 1: $1,580: $1,215: 2: $2,137: $1,644: 3: $2,694: $2,072: 4: $3,250: …Oct 26, 2023 · Gross Monthly Income: A household's gross monthly income, which is the total income before any deductions, generally must be at or below 130% of the FPL to qualify for SNAP benefits. Net Monthly Income: After accounting for allowable deductions, the household's net income must be at or below 100% of the FPL. The below income limits are set by the Federal government and are subject to change each October 1. The gross monthly income limit is set at 130 percent of the Federal Poverty Line (FPL) and the net monthly income limit is set at 100 percent of the FPL. Self-employed households. Revised 9-16-19. (a) Person considered self-employed. A person is considered self-employed when: (1) he or she declares himself or herself to be self-employed; (2) there is an employer/employee relationship and the employer does not withhold income taxes or Federal Insurance Contributions Act (FICA), even ...
